Subwoofer matching
Kalali, the idea that a smaller subwoofer is faster is incorrect. Given appropriately designed motors a 15" sub is just as fast as a 10" sub. The 15" driver does not have to move as far to produce the same output so typically larger drivers have l...

Fidelity Research FR-54 Tonearm. ANTI-SKATE???
Elliot, there is no direct relationship between tracking force and the weight of the anti skate bob. I do believe there was an add on weight that threaded into the bob. At any rate, set up your cartridge and tonearm. When you place the needle in t...
